Data Engineer

Cross Screen Media, LLC
Alexandria, United States of America
1 month ago

Role details

Contract type
Permanent contract
Employment type
Full-time (> 32 hours)
Working hours
Regular working hours
Languages
English
Experience level
Senior

Job location

Remote
Alexandria, United States of America

Tech stack

Airflow
Amazon Web Services (AWS)
Unit Testing
Cloud Database
Static Program Analysis
Data Architecture
Information Engineering
ETL
Database Queries
Python
Snowflake
Data Layers
Information Technology
Data Pipelines

Job description

Cross Screen Media is founded by industry veterans and gives customers a new way to plan and execute video advertising campaigns. To achieve this, we need an amazing team. Here's where you come in… We are looking to hire a Data Engineer with a strong work ethic and a passion for the fast-paced startup life. The ideal candidate doesn't just build pipelines - they think critically about how data should be modeled, how systems connect, and how to design for scale. You'll work alongside a senior data engineer and collaborate across a small, high-output team to shape the data layer behind our product, ScreenSolve. We're currently using tools and platforms like Python, Airflow, dbt, AWS and Snowflake. This is a fully remote position. Face to face communication is important to us, so we have quarterly in-person team meetings at our office in Alexandria, VA. Additionally, we have biannual company offsites to give all of our employees time together in person., + Design and develop data pipelines, with an eye toward how they fit into the broader data architecture

  • Make data modeling and schema design decisions - choosing the right structure for how data is stored, accessed, and extended
  • Think beyond the immediate task: consider how today's integration point becomes tomorrow's platform surface area
  • Deliver features rapidly using AI-assisted development tools (Claude Code, etc.)
  • Contribute to definition of user stories
  • Collaborate with other members of the team on development & integration
  • Write unit tests and maintain high code quality, per both static code analysis & team standards
  • Be available on a rotating schedule for production issues

Requirements

  • BS in Computer Science or equivalent
  • 5+ years experience in software/data engineering
  • Strong SQL skills
  • Experience with ETL/ELT techniques
  • Strong sense for data architecture - you can look at a set of requirements and reason about how data should be modeled, where it should live, and how schemas should be designed for clarity and reuse
  • Experience with dbt
  • Experience with Airflow or similar orchestration tools
  • Experience with Snowflake or similar cloud data warehouses
  • Experience working with AWS
  • Unix/Linux fundamentals
  • Nice to have: Experience with AI coding tools
  • Nice to have: Exposure to ad tech concepts & terminology

Benefits & conditions

  • Competitive salary with high bonus potential
  • Collaborative and creative atmosphere, with inspired leadership
  • Career advancement opportunities
  • Recognition and reward for outstanding performance
  • Great medical, dental & vision Insurance packages
  • Competitive 401K with company match to plan for the long term
  • Unlimited paid-time-off
  • Transportation benefits & cell phone reimbursement Unfortunately we are not able to sponsor visas for this position.

Apply for this position